Job Summary:

Allstate is hiring for a Product Senior Consultant. The selected individual will be responsible for supporting strategic business decisions by evaluating trends and reporting and monitoring key business metrics. They will apply business knowledge gained in the role to analyze our competitive landscape, execute underwriting and product changes, and be responsible for completion of projects of moderate to high complexity. This is a remote - homebased opportunity.

Key Responsibilities:

* Understanding of the Profit and Loss and key insurance metrics with the ability to identify emerging trends and make recommendations to inform product management teams.
* Leverage various data sources and applications to retrieve, conduct research, manipulate data, report build and perform moderate to complex analysis to support the different product teams
* With some oversight, Influence business decisions through storytelling and presentation of data and analysis. Effectively communicate results to Senior Leadership
* Actively participate in coordinated efforts across the organization to facilitate and lead the implementation of moderate to complex initiatives (including product, pricing, contract, and underwriting)
* Owns moderate to complex procedures and processes regularly and recommends alternatives or improvements to influence product design, business strategy, and underwriting philosophy
* Provide moderate to complex technical guidance and influence the work of others; simplify difficult concepts for non-technical users
* Build business partnerships by demonstrating knowledge and understanding of customer needs and other internal/external partners
* Contribute to a supportive team environment, enabling quality team interactions and deliverables (e.g., develop trust within team, reinforce and apply team expectations, appropriately challenge team members and peers, celebrate success and learnings)
* Mentors and provides training to other team members

Education and Experience:
*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ience
* 3 or more years of related experience
Functional Skills:
* Intermediate: Microsoft Office Suite of tools, specifically Excel, PowerPoint, Word
* Intermediate knowledge of data retrieval, sources, and reporting such as SQL, Business Objects, and Tableau
* Strong attention to detail; can analyze data and review analysis from others and identify and resolve data issues of moderate complexity
* Intermediate: oral and written communication skills with ability to effectively communicate specialized terms and data
* Organizational and time management skills with ability to adjust to multiple demands and shifting proprieties; accepts responsibility for results of actions
* Enjoys collaborating with others to build and maintain ongoing partner relationships both within and outside area of expertise
